#001d43 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#001d43 is composed of 0% red, 11.4%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 100% cyan, 56.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 73.7% black. It has a hue angle of 214 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 13.1%. #001d43 color hex could be obtained by blending #003a86 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

Shades and Tints of #001d43

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000408 is the darkest color, while #f4f8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#001d43

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#1f2124 is the less saturated color, while #001d43 is the most saturated one.
